A bail bond is a financial agreement that allows an apprehended individual to be released from custody while waiting for test. This arrangement includes a 3rd event, commonly a bondsman, who ensures the court that the individual will return for their arranged court looks. In exchange for this service, the bondsman usually charges a non-refundable charge, frequently a portion of the overall Bail amount.Bail bonds serve an essential feature in the lawful system, providing a system for defendants to preserve their flexibility during the pre-trial stage. This can help them get ready for their defense much more efficiently. The Bail quantity is determined by the court based on various elements, consisting of the seriousness of the violation, the offender's criminal background, and the threat of flight. Ultimately, a bail bond represents a dedication to maintain legal obligations while permitting individuals the possibility to proceed their day-to-days live up until their court date.
Exactly How Bail Bonds Job
Bail bonds operate with a straightforward process that involves numerous essential actions. An accused or their depictive calls a bail bond representative after an arrest. The agent examines the circumstance, consisting of the Bail quantity set by the court and the accused's background. Once a choice is made, the representative generally calls for a non-refundable charge, normally a portion of the total Bail amount, typically ranging from 10% to 15%.After the charge is paid, the agent secures the Bail by signing a contract with the court, making certain that the defendant stands for all arranged court dates. If the accused fails to appear, the bail bond representative is liable for the complete Bail amount, leading the representative to seek the offender. Throughout this process, the bail bond representative plays an essential duty in facilitating the release of the accused while managing the connected economic risks.
Kinds of Bail Bonds
Recognizing the various sorts of Bail bonds is essential for accuseds and their families as they navigate the legal system. There are numerous typical sorts of Bail bonds available, each offering a details objective.The most prevalent is the surety bond, which involves a bondsman guaranteeing the full Bail amount for a fee. An additional kind is the cash bond, where the offender or their family members pays the full Bail amount in cash money straight to the court.
Home bonds permit individuals to use actual estate as collateral for the Bail amount. Furthermore, federal bonds are specific to federal cases, usually calling for a higher premium and extra rigorous conditions.
Ultimately, migration bonds are used in cases concerning migration violations. Each kind of bond has unique treatments and effects, making it vital for those included to comprehend their options thoroughly.
The Costs Associated With Securing a Bail Bond
Protecting a bail bond entails various expenses that can considerably affect a defendant's finances. The major expense is the premium, commonly varying from 10% to 15% of the overall Bail quantity set by the court. This premium is non-refundable, regardless of the case end result, representing the bail bond representative's cost for their solutions. Extra prices may include management fees, which some representatives impose for handling documents, and collateral requirements, where the defendant may need to offer assets to secure the bond. In cases involving greater Bail amounts, the requirement for security comes to be extra obvious. bail bonds. Accuseds need to be aware of potential prices connected to missed out on court days, which can lead to more monetary fines. Understanding these costs is essential for accuseds and their family members, as they can considerably affect the financial burden linked with safeguarding a bail bond

Usual Misconceptions Regarding Bail Bonds
Several individuals nurture mistaken beliefs about Bail bonds, which can complicate their understanding of the Bail procedure. One common myth learn this here now is that Bail bonds are a kind of payment that assures an accused's release. Actually, they are a warranty to the court that the defendant will certainly stand for their scheduled hearings. One more usual idea is that just wealthy individuals can pay for Bail. Nevertheless, bondsman typically charge a percentage of the overall Bail quantity, making it obtainable to a broader range of individuals. In addition, some individuals assume that Bail is refundable. While the premium paid to the bondsman is not refundable, the Bail amount itself might be returned upon the completion of the instance, provided the offender meets all court requirements.
